Greenhouse Farming: A Revolution in Modern Agriculture
Introduction to Greenhouse Farming
Greenhouse farming is an advanced agricultural technique that provides a controlled environment for plant growth, protecting crops from harsh weather conditions and pests. A greenhouse is a structure made of glass or plastic that traps solar radiation, creating a warm and stable climate ideal for plant development. This method allows for year-round cultivation, higher yields, and better-quality crops, making it a crucial innovation in modern agriculture.

Uses of Greenhouses in Agriculture
1- Year-Round Cultivation One of the primary benefits of greenhouse farming is the ability to grow crops in all seasons, regardless of external weather conditions. By regulating temperature, humidity, and light, farmers can cultivate fruits, vegetables, and flowers even in regions with extreme climates.
2- Growing High-Value Crops Greenhouses are commonly used to grow high-value crops that require specific conditions, such as:
Tomatoes 🍅
Cucumbers 🥒
Strawberries 🍓
Lettuce & Leafy Greens 🥬
Peppers & Chilies 🌶
Orchids & Flowers 🌺
These crops thrive in stable environments, leading to higher market value and increased profits for farmers.
3- Protection from Pests & Diseases Greenhouses provide a barrier against harmful insects and pests, reducing the need for chemical pesticides. This not only protects crops but also promotes organic farming and ensures healthier produce for consumers.
4- Water Efficiency & Drip Irrigation Greenhouse farming often incorporates drip irrigation systems, which supply water directly to plant roots, reducing water wastage and enhancing nutrient absorption. This method is particularly beneficial in regions facing water scarcity.
5- Climate Control & Automation Modern greenhouses are equipped with automated systems for:
✅ Temperature regulation
✅ Humidity control
✅ CO₂ enrichment for faster plant growth
✅ Artificial lighting for enhanced photosynthesis These technologies ensure optimal growing conditions, maximizing crop yield and quality.

Types of Greenhouses
1️⃣ Glass Greenhouses – Traditional, durable, and ideal for long-term farming.
2️⃣ Plastic Greenhouses – Cost-effective, lightweight, and widely used.
3️⃣ Tunnel Greenhouses – Simple structures with plastic covers, commonly used for vegetables.
4️⃣ Hydroponic Greenhouses – Use soilless farming techniques, where plants grow in nutrient-rich water.

Advantages of Greenhouse Farming
🌱 Higher Crop Yields – Increases production compared to open-field farming.
🌍 Environmental Sustainability – Reduces water and pesticide usage.
💰 Economic Benefits – Allows for premium-quality crops, leading to higher profits.
🛡 Protection Against Climate Change – Shields plants from extreme weather, such as frost, drought, and heavy rain.
🔬 Research & Innovation – Enables scientists to experiment with new crop varieties and cultivation techniques.
